Gastric Banding
Gastric banding is a procedure where a band is placed around your stomach to gently restrict your food intake. This is a safe and easy procedure to undergo and has the advantage of being reversible. Gastric Bypass
Gastric bypass is a more invasive procedure where parts of your digestive system are modified to hinder your body’s ability to absorb food.
